Masonry Staining Cost Overview
The state of the masonry surface affects preparation work and costs involved.
Different staining products vary in price based on quality and durability.
Larger projects typically incur higher overall costs due to increased labor and materials.
| Factor | Impact on Cost |
|---|---|
| Surface Condition | Damaged or uneven surfaces require additional prep, increasing costs. |
| Material Type | Premium stains cost more but offer longer-lasting results. |
| Project Size | More extensive areas lead to higher material and labor expenses. |
| Location | Urban areas may have higher labor rates compared to rural locations. |
| Accessibility | Hard-to-reach areas increase labor time and costs. |
| Surface Complexity | Intricate masonry designs may require specialized techniques, raising costs. |
| Number of Coats | Multiple coats increase material use and labor hours. |
| Weather Conditions | Adverse weather can delay work and increase costs. |

Thorough cleaning and repairs are essential for optimal staining results and impact costs.
Interior staining projects may involve different materials and techniques affecting cost.
Applying sealants or protective layers adds to the overall expense but enhances longevity.
| Service | Average Price |
|---|---|
| Basic Masonry Staining | $2.50 - $4.00 per sq ft |
| Premium Masonry Staining | $4.00 - $6.50 per sq ft |
| Interior Masonry Staining | $3.00 - $5.50 per sq ft |
| Surface Repair and Preparation | $1.00 - $3.00 per sq ft |
| Sealant Application | $1.50 - $3.00 per sq ft |
| Color Customization | $0.50 - $1.50 per sq ft |
| Patterned Staining | $4.00 - $7.00 per sq ft |
| Large-Scale Commercial Projects | $2.00 - $3.50 per sq ft |
| Historic Masonry Restoration | $5.00 - $10.00 per sq ft |
| Interior Wall Masonry Staining | $3.00 - $6.00 per sq ft |
